在当今的互联网时代,网站已经成为了企业和个人展示自己的重要平台,一个优秀的网站不仅需要有吸引人的界面设计,更需要有良好的布局和样式来提升用户体验,CSS布局是实现网页布局的关键手段之一,本文将探讨如何通过优化CSS布局来提升网站的用户体验。
理解CSS布局的重要性
CSS布局是指通过CSS代码对网页中的元素进行定位、排列和组合,从而形成美观、易用的网站界面,一个良好的CSS布局可以使网页结构清晰、层次分明,同时也能提高页面加载速度和交互性,了解CSS布局的重要性对于网站开发者来说至关重要。
CSS布局的基本原则
-
响应式设计:随着移动设备的普及,越来越多的用户通过手机等移动设备访问网站,CSS布局需要考虑到不同设备的屏幕尺寸和分辨率,采用响应式设计,使网站在不同设备上都能保持良好的视觉效果和用户体验。
-
简洁明了:CSS布局应该尽量保持简洁明了,避免过多的样式规则和复杂的布局结构,这样不仅可以提高代码的可读性和可维护性,还可以减少浏览器渲染的时间,提高页面加载速度。
-
兼容性:CSS布局需要考虑不同浏览器的兼容性问题,确保在不同的浏览器上都能正常显示和运行,这可以通过使用CSS预处理器(如Sass或Less)来实现,同时还需要关注最新的浏览器标准和特性。
CSS布局的优化技巧
-
使用CSS选择器:合理使用CSS选择器可以提高代码的可读性和可维护性,可以使用类选择器(.class)来选择具有相同样式的元素,使用ID选择器(#id)来选择具有特定ID的元素,等等。
-
利用CSS属性:CSS属性可以提供更丰富的样式效果,如背景颜色、字体大小、边框样式等,通过合理利用CSS属性,可以增强页面的视觉效果和交互性。
-
合并样式规则:将相似的样式规则合并到一个样式规则中,可以减少重复代码的出现,提高代码的可读性和可维护性,可以将多个
margin属性合并为一个样式规则,或者将多个padding属性合并为一个样式规则。 -
使用CSS媒体查询:CSS媒体查询可以根据不同的屏幕尺寸和分辨率来应用不同的样式规则,从而实现响应式设计,可以使用
@media关键字来定义针对不同屏幕尺寸的样式规则。 -
使用CSS动画和过渡:CSS动画和过渡可以增加页面的动态效果和交互性,通过合理使用CSS动画和过渡,可以让页面更加生动有趣,提高用户的浏览体验。
CSS布局是实现网站布局的关键手段之一,通过理解CSS布局的重要性、遵循基本原则、运用优化技巧,我们可以打造出一个既美观又实用的网站界面。

总浏览